Check out tips for playing Tales of the Rays on Android and iOS

Tales of the Rays is the new series RPG for Android and iOS. The title brings together all the characters in the franchise, but this time with a very different gameplay from Tales of Link. With 3D graphics and more freedom to explore, the player has full control over combat and can unlock new weapons and gear in a "gatcha" system. How to get Mirrorgems

Mirrorgems are stones used in a "gatcha" system to unlock weapons and new scams for the characters. You can get Mirrorgems in a variety of ways, but there are easier methods to accumulate them quickly, like the campaign's extra goals.

Secondary tasks appear in a three-crowned icon on the map of any mission in the main campaign. In this menu "Mission Clear Info" there are mini challenges to complete and give as bonus Mirrorgems. They are relatively easy to be fulfilled and you can get a good amount of extra gems. It is worth remembering that you do not need to complete them to complete the main chapters.

Another way to get gems is through mission rewards, which appear on the home screen of "The Bridge." They are of all kinds: normal, daily, event, and limited. Normals are permanent and unlocked as you progress through the campaign. The daily ones have time limits, but they are the easiest ones to do. Stay tuned for specials or events, as these last for a few days and have important bonuses.

But do not just stick to the parallel missions. During special weeks, you'll have access to additional story chapters with bonus items and Mirrorgems for participating players. Complete all the goals and extras you can get to receive weapons and items.

Complete the special missions

Tales of the Rays has a myriad of chapters and adventures. In some, the game offers bonuses so players can get items or experience faster. In the "Quests" menu complete the special quests to receive twice Gald, Experience, Animaorb and Crystal. They appear in the list with different colors and highlight your bonus in the pictures.

Make good use of automatic mode

As in other mobile RPGs, Tales of the Rays includes an automatic mode, which leaves the game itself in control of the character. "Auto Play" is very useful for those who want to gain experience or repeat missions that give money and special items. To use it, click and hold your finger on the screen until the icon is activated. This mode is available in both the main campaign and combat.

However, automatic mode should be used with caution, as your actions are limited. The character will choose the shortest path to complete the map and leave behind monsters and treasure chests. It is also not advisable to use it in boss fights or maps with many bonus chests because the artificial intelligence of the game is scarce.

Another way to use Auto Play in a useful way is when choosing your equipment. Before entering a mission, you can ask the game to select the best paraphernalia for your characters. If in doubt about what to use, leave it in the hands of the "Best Equip" option.

Choose the strongest player

You can bring an extra character to the missions. He is from another player and appears in a list before entering a chapter or quest. When choosing, always take the strongest. To see which one has the best potential, pay attention to the colors. Bonus players appear highlighted with green outline within the list.

Use the beginner discount

The "gatcha" system works like a draw. You spend a lot of gems and the game will draw one of the items from the list for you to receive. Since summoning is not cheap, the game offers little help to beginners. As you begin, use your beginner discount to make a 1x Summon. The normal price of this invocation is 200 gems, but the novice will pay only 100.

Do not forget to save your game.

A recurring problem with mobile games is the saves. As a partially online game, Tales of the Rays does not link your data to your mobile phone either; he needs to be connected to a Bandai Namco account or to Facebook. If it is not and you end up deleting or uninstalling the game by accident, you may lose all your data, Mirrorgems and characters unlocked.

To prevent this from happening, link your account to Facebook or create a Bandai Namco account through the application. Here's how to do it step by step:

Step 1. Open the Tales of the Rays and click on "Menu";

Step 2. Click "Transfer Settings";

Step 3. Now choose an account to connect your data and select "Assing".

By choosing Facebook, the game will ask you to enter your account information or just confirm it if you are already connected to the application on your phone. When you select the Bandai Namco account, it will also ask for your information if you already have an account, or open a form for you to create a new one.

If you need to change your device or uninstall, simply enter the same option and click on the account in which you connected your Tales of the Rays save. It will recover the entire game on the new device. However, while performing the transfer, be aware that the number of Mirrorgems in your account will be reset to zero. The gems that are stored in the Gift Box can still be redeemed after the transfer.
